First-Time Patient Tips

First-time visitors should arrive 15 minutes early and bring their insurance card, photo ID, current medication list, and recent lab results if available within the past six months. Consider maintaining a three-day food diary before your visit to help providers understand your current eating patterns and identify potential problem areas. Wear comfortable clothing for the physical exam and body composition analysis, and bring a list of questions about treatment options, expected timeline, and potential side effects.

Prepare mentally by setting realistic expectations about the weight loss process. Medical weight loss typically produces 1-3 pounds of loss per week initially, with slower but steady progress over 6-18 months. Be honest about previous diet attempts, current stress levels, and any concerns about medications or lifestyle changes. Consider your support system at home and work, as sustainable weight loss often requires family cooperation and workplace accommodation for meal timing and medical appointments. Remember that successful medical weight loss is a collaborative process requiring active participation in both medical treatment and behavioral changes.

What is the difference between Ozempic and Mounjaro for weight loss?
Ozempic (semaglutide) targets GLP-1 receptors and typically produces 10-15% body weight reduction in clinical trials. Mounjaro (tirzepatide) targets both GLP-1 and GIP receptors, often resulting in 15-22% weight loss with potentially better glucose control. Tirzepatide generally shows superior weight loss outcomes but may have higher rates of gastrointestinal side effects initially. Both require weekly injections and similar dietary modifications. Individual response varies significantly, so the choice depends on your medical history, other medications, and tolerability. How do I check if I qualify for GLP-1 weight loss medication?
GLP-1 medications are FDA-approved for weight loss in adults with BMI ≥30, or BMI ≥27 with weight-related health conditions like diabetes, high blood pressure, or sleep apnea. Additional factors include unsuccessful previous weight loss attempts and commitment to lifestyle modifications. Medical contraindications include personal or family history of certain thyroid cancers, severe gastroparesis, or pregnancy.
